Huawei has recently introduced the industry’s first commercial new smart Hybrid cooling energy storage solution in Europe. It comes with several benefits and offers a circulation efficiency of 91.3% alongside a reliable user experience. On April 8, 2025, Huawei hosted a FusionSolar Industrial and Commercial Flagship Summit in Frankfurt, Germany.
In terms of power, consumers can merge the 215kWh Hybrid cooling energy storage solution with Huawei’s 150kWh higher-power inverter and ultra-fast charging technology to generate the “three-hexagonal warriors” of light storage-charging. (source)
This has eventually established a new industry milestone in the six most critical standards for evaluating energy storage systems. A hybrid cooling energy storage system offers a 91.3% circulation efficiency. It has a unique pack optimizer with 100% DOD (depth of discharge) and a unique heat dissipation technology with 2% higher SOH.
The global industrial and commercial energy storage market is experiencing explosive growth, with demand increasing by over 250% in the past two years. Containerized energy storage solutions now account for approximately 45% of all new commercial and industrial storage deployments worldwide. North America leads with 42% market share, driven by corporate sustainability initiatives and tax incentives that reduce total project costs by 18-28%. Europe follows closely with 35% market share, where standardized industrial storage designs have cut installation timelines by 65% compared to traditional built-in-place systems. Asia-Pacific represents the fastest-growing region at 50% CAGR, with manufacturing scale reducing system prices by 20% annually. Emerging markets in Africa and Latin America are adopting industrial storage solutions for peak shaving and backup power, with typical payback periods of 2-4 years. Major commercial projects now deploy clusters of 15+ systems creating storage networks with 80+MWh capacity at costs below $270/kWh for large-scale industrial applications.
